About Converting Grams per Milliliter to Stones per Cubic Centimeter
Gram per Milliliter and Stone per Cubic Centimeter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Formula
stones per cubic centimeter = grams per milliliter × 0.000157473044418
This factor comes from each unit's defined relationship to the category's base unit: 1 gram per milliliter equals 1000 base units, and 1 stone per cubic centimeter equals 6350293.18 base units, so dividing one by the other gives the direct gram per milliliter-to-stone per cubic centimeter factor of 0.000157473044418.

Understanding the Gram per Milliliter
Gram per Milliliter (g/mL) measures density. Numerically identical to grams per cubic centimeter and to kilograms per liter, since one milliliter equals one cubic centimeter exactly. It is classified as a metric derived density unit.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
